One way to protect your account is by enabling 2-step login verification.
2-step login verification links an SMS-enabled mobile phone to our account so that the phone can receive a special login pin when we need to connect from a new device, browser, or computer.
However, unlike with several other service providers, Apple has taken a lot of heat from the press for having a 2-Step Login system that is not as secure as users might hope it is. Apple has gone for lighter security, in favor of ease of use, the opposite route that Google takes with their 2-Step Login.

To Get Started:
Log into Apple via the AppleID page.

Click "Manage your Apple ID," then "Password and Security." Select the "Get Started" option.

Now, follow the onscreen instructions.

Apple will send you an email in three days, with instructions on how to finalize the two-step verification.
Unlike other services, Apple also sends you a 14-digit Recovery Key, which you can use to regain your account if you ever lose access to your devices or forget your password.
